Landing Deals: The Science Behind Success
Understanding the psychology behind deal-making can significantly improve your chances of closing contracts. It's not just about demonstrating a fantastic product or service; it's about building strong relationships, understanding client needs, and effectively communicating your value proposition. Successful negotiators often harness techniques based on cognitive biases, positioning information in a way that influences the other party.
For example, the concept of scarcity can be exploited to create a sense of urgency and drive decisions. Additionally, active listening allows you to reveal pain points and tailor your solution accordingly.
Convert From Prospect to Profit: A Sales Journey
A thriving sales journey isn't simply about finalizing agreements. It's a meticulously orchestrated process that guides prospects through various stages, ultimately achieving a profitable outcome.
The initial step is discovering potential customers. Once identified, these prospects need tailored engagements to establish rapport. Through convincing communication, you can highlight the advantages of your products.
As the relationship progresses, it's crucial to address any reservations prospects may have. Honesty and active listening are critical for gaining confidence. Finally, when prospects are willing, a seamless transaction can be completed, marking the culmination of a profitable sales journey.
Developing a High-Performing Sales Team
Cultivating a high-performing sales team necessitates a well-thought-out approach. It involves recruiting top talent, putting into place robust training programs, and fostering a atmosphere of support. Providing your team with the assets they must have to succeed is paramount. Regularly monitoring performance and offering valuable feedback can greatly enhance their effectiveness.
- Remember that a high-performing sales team is not built overnight.
- It takes time, commitment, and a willingness to evolve as the market transforms.
